In this paper, we have studied the conformational and opto-electronic
properties of several oligomers of bridged oligo(bithiophene)s (BTX)n , n=1 to 4 with (X:
CH2, SiH2, C=O, C=S and C=C(CN)2). The conformational analysis shows that the most
stable conformation is anti-planar conformation. The opto-electronic properties of the
octamer (OTX) lead us to suggest that this oligomer is a good model to reflect optoelectronic properties for the parent polymer.
